It may be late news, but better than never.  After a few weeks of discussions with FDJ I finally signed the dotted line for another year in the pro ranks.  It sure was a relief to finally sign as my head had been turning for few weeks over all the possible outcomes.  I had thought often to keep you all informed on what was happening contract and race wise, but I just found it so hard to sit down at the computer to write a post on such shaky ground.  Though my form on the bike had been fairly solid, maybe not picking up the individual results I had hoped for, I’ve produced some impressive lead outs and been in a lot of breakaways to please the bosses.

So with the contract signed it was on the plane back to NZ to put the feet up for a real offie.   At the end of last year I just had a weeks spell between racing the track for NZ and pulling the FDJ whites back on, and gearing up for the road nationals in January.  As I concluded my season this year with the Crono des Nations just last weekend it made for a very long 10month season with over 90 days of racing in the legs, the body has been screaming for a break.

The bike will be put away for 3-4weeks now and I will be enjoying catching up with family and friends, before the task of straightening out and shaping up the body for another season begins.

I would like to thank you all for your support this year, it has been amazing.  It was a real learning curve for me and I hope you learnt a few thing along the way too.  Next year I’m sure there will still be some learning to be done but I will endeavour to turn what I already know into results.
